Key Steps for Effective Fall Lawn Maintenance
Establishing a strong foundation through autumn lawn care involves several essential practices. Let's explore the key strategies that can help your lawn thrive:
Aerate Your Lawn
One of the most effective ways to kickstart your fall lawn care is through aeration. By loosening compacted soil, you allow nutrients, water, and air to penetrate deeply to the roots. Fall is a perfect time for aeration, as the soil is still warm enough to promote recovery from the process.
Fertilize Wisely
Late-season fertilization with a nitrogen-rich product, often referred to as a lawn winterizer, is crucial. This application nourishes the grass, helping it survive frost and diseases over winter. It’s advisable to test your soil beforehand to avoid damaging your grass through over-fertilization.
Consider Overseeding
If you live in a cooler climate, overseeding can be an invaluable component of your fall maintenance routine. Increasing seed density in thinning areas ensures a fuller, healthier lawn when spring arrives. The cool temperatures and moisture in the fall create ideal conditions for new grass seed to establish itself.
Weed Management
Weeds that emerged during the summer need to be managed as fall rolls in. Applying post-emergent treatments between August and October can effectively diminish their presence while the weather is still agreeable.
